WebDrip chambers can be classified into macro-drip (about 10 to 20 gtts/ml) and micro-drip (about 60 gtts/ml) based on their drop factors. Free shipping for many products! Web23 jan. 2024 · This is supported by Harding et al. (2024) who found out that up to 35% of medication may not be administered due to residual volume, with the greatest percentage associated with 50-ml solutions ... Web6 dec. 2024 · The rate is measured by counting the number of drops that fall into the drip chamber each minute. Macrodrip tubing is wider, producing larger drops and is available in three sizes: 10, 15, or 20 drops ... (500 mL) over 2 hours. You select IV tubing with a drip factor of 15 drops/mL. Macro drip tubing can deliver between 10 gtt/mL and 15 gtt/mL. This means it can take as few as 10 drips to infuse one milliliter.
